IDIVAL Good Clinical Practice Standards Course

23 de August de 2021

The Marqués de Valdecilla Research Institute (IDIVAL) is organising a course on Standards of Good Clinical Practice from 27 September to 27 October, aimed at all staff in the bio-health sector in Cantabria who are interested in clinical research.

With this training activity, IDIVAL's aim is to provide to these professionals the necessary tools for their participation in clinical research, offering them the principles of Good Clinical Practice according to the International Conference on Harmonisation (ICH) required to be able to participate in clinical research projects.

On-line training. The zoom platform will be used to teach the contents.

Duration: 26 hours, 2 hours per session, from 16:00 to 18:00.

Number of places: 100

Accreditation: Pending accreditation by the Continuous Training Commission for health professionals in Cantabria. A diploma of attendance will be provided to all attendees.
